Governor’s Cup Golf from Aug 23
KARACHI, July 24: Country’s top amateur golfers will be seen in action in the second edition of Sindh Governor’s Cup which is scheduled to be staged at the DHA Golf Club on August 23-24, Secretary Sindh Golf Association (SGA) Asad I.A.Khan announced on Thursday.
“We successfully launched this event last year and it is on the calendar of Pakistan Golf Federation,” the SGA Secretary said. “We are expecting more than 100 entries from all top amateur golfers of the country,” he added.
The main amateur event, spread over two days, will be played over 36-holes while seniors, juniors and ladies events will be played over 18 holes and veterans will feature in 9-hole contest.
Asad said SGA holds their events — Sindh Open, Governor’s Cup and Sindh Amateur Golf — on rotation basis at three clubs of the city, namely Karachi Golf, Arabian Sea Country Club and DHA Club.—APP
